Output e408f7632beeffe0911200641c209941832e0eec4a62ac8878b1161795fb28d6:5

value
250000
script pubkey
OP_0 OP_PUSHBYTES_20 bbc3345e06756ef77ed4cb3de20b2e87e01f752c
address
bc1qh0pnghsxw4h0wlk5ev77yzewslsp7afv4mthhv
transaction
e408f7632beeffe0911200641c209941832e0eec4a62ac8878b1161795fb28d6
confirmations
140055
spent
true